2026 ICD-10-CM Diagnosis Code I08.9 – Rheumatic multiple valve disease, unspecified
What it is
I08.9 identifies rheumatic disease affecting more than one heart valve, but the specific valves and severity are not documented. Use it when the record confirms rheumatic multivalvular involvement without further detail.
Clinical signs
Clinical features vary; refer to documentation. Findings may include murmurs, evidence of valve dysfunction, or a history of rheumatic fever with multiple affected valves.
When to use this code
Use I08.9 when the provider documents rheumatic disease of multiple valves and does not name the valves or specify the lesion. It also fits when the chart says rheumatic multivalvular disease, unspecified. Check documentation if the note instead identifies one valve or a nonrheumatic cause.
Do not use for
Do not use this code for isolated rheumatic disease of a single valve or for nonrheumatic valvular disorders. If the documentation specifies the valve or lesion type, code that more precise diagnosis instead.
Coding tip
Assign I08.9 only when the record clearly supports rheumatic involvement of multiple valves and no further valve detail is available.
